一種多路紅外遙控系統(tǒng)的電路設(shè)計和實現(xiàn)
由于本多路遙控系統(tǒng)主要是針對目前家庭眾多的家電設(shè)備的集中管理,所以該系統(tǒng)的控制對象大都是220V交流負載。首先AT89C2051對MC33993進行初始化,將MC33993的所有的開關(guān)檢測端口均設(shè)置為浮空狀態(tài),在遙控接收電路成功解調(diào)出遙控指令后,由AT89C2051通過與MC33993的SPI口的串行通信輸出對應(yīng)的控制信號給MC33993,使MC33993相應(yīng)的端口為可控硅光絕緣驅(qū)動器MC3021的輸入發(fā)光二極管提供驅(qū)動電流,然后MC3021驅(qū)動三端雙向可控硅BT136導(dǎo)通,交流負載接通電源開始工作。當(dāng)再次按下同一遙控按鍵時,AT89C2051輸出控制信號取反,使MC33993相應(yīng)的端口斷開,不再為可控硅光絕緣驅(qū)動器MC3021的輸入發(fā)光二極管提供驅(qū)動電流,BT136喪失了MC3021的驅(qū)動,BT136截止,交流負載電源斷開使其停止工作。輸出控制電路參見圖3.由于篇幅限制,圖中只畫出了第一路和第22路輸出控制。
通常,需要大量開關(guān)接口和輸出控制電路的系統(tǒng)往往由許多分立器件組成,眾多的分立器件不僅在電路板上占據(jù)較大空間,而且必須仔細檢查焊接的完整性。而將功能靈活的MC33993應(yīng)用于多路遙控的鍵盤控制與輸出控制中,減少了電路板的焊接和尺寸,同時又可提供非常靈活的接口,并且還具有睡眠工作模式,大大降低了系統(tǒng)的功耗。這樣,用較少的CPU資源和簡潔的電路設(shè)計,既解決了多控制按鍵的輸入問題,又解決了多控制輸出問題。MC33993是電子產(chǎn)品開發(fā)中非常理想的選擇。
由于紅外線遙控不具有像無線電遙控那樣穿過障礙物去控制被控對象的能力,所以,在設(shè)計家用電器的紅外線遙控器時,不必要像無線電遙控器那樣,每套(發(fā)射器和接收器)要有不同的遙控頻率或編碼(否則,就會隔墻控制或干擾鄰居的家用電器),所以同類產(chǎn)品的紅外線遙控器,可以有相同的遙控頻率或編碼,而不會出現(xiàn)遙控信號串門的情況。
評論